RLLTE:强化学习的长期演进项目
项目介绍
RLLTE(Reinforcement Learning Long-Term Evolution)是一个受到电信领域长期演进(LTE)标准项目启发的强化学习项目。其目标是为强化学习研究和应用提供开发组件和标准,推动该领域的发展。RLLTE不仅提供了顶尖的算法实现,还作为一个工具包,帮助开发者轻松构建和优化强化学习算法。
项目技术分析
RLLTE的核心技术优势在于其模块化设计和硬件加速支持。项目采用了模块化的设计理念,使得强化学习算法可以完全解耦,开发者可以根据需求自由组合和替换模块。此外,RLLTE支持多种计算设备,包括NVIDIA GPU和HUAWEI NPU,确保了算法在不同硬件平台上的高效运行。
项目及技术应用场景
RLLTE适用于多种强化学习应用场景,包括但不限于:
- 游戏AI开发:通过内置的算法和环境,开发者可以快速训练游戏AI,提升游戏体验。
- 机器人控制:RLLTE的模块化设计使得开发者可以轻松实现复杂的机器人控制任务。
- 自动驾驶:通过支持多种计算设备,RLLTE可以应用于自动驾驶系统的训练和优化。
项目特点
- 长期演进:不断更新和引入最新的算法和技巧,保持项目的先进性。
- 完整生态系统:提供从任务设计、模型训练到评估和部署的全流程支持。
- 模块化设计:强化学习算法的完全解耦,方便开发者自由组合和替换模块。
- 硬件加速:支持多种计算设备,包括GPU和NPU,确保算法的高效运行。
- 自定义支持:支持自定义环境和模块,满足不同应用需求。
- 丰富的基准测试:提供大量可复用的基准测试数据,方便开发者进行性能评估。
- AI助手:集成大型语言模型,提供智能化的开发辅助功能。
结语
RLLTE作为一个全面且先进的强化学习工具包,为开发者提供了强大的功能和灵活的定制选项。无论你是强化学习领域的研究者,还是希望在实际应用中使用强化学习技术的开发者,RLLTE都将是你的理想选择。立即加入RLLTE社区,开启你的强化学习之旅吧!
项目链接:RLLTE GitHub
文档链接:RLLTE 文档